Understanding School Notification Laws in Pennsylvania
In Pennsylvania, school notification laws for juvenile sex offenders are governed by the Sexual Offender Registration and Notification Act (SORNA). This comprehensive legislation aims to protect communities by ensuring that individuals convicted of sexual offenses, including juveniles, are properly registered and their locations disclosed. When a juvenile sex offender is involved in an incident in or around Philadelphia, PA, schools are legally required to be notified. This process involves the local law enforcement agency providing notice to the school administration, who then must inform parents, guardians, and relevant staff about the presence of such an individual.

Juvenile Sex Offender Registration Requirements
In Philadelphia, PA, juvenile sex offenders face distinct registration requirements set by law. These mandates are designed to ensure public safety and transparency, aiming to inform communities about potential risks. Under these regulations, juveniles convicted of certain sexual offenses must register with local law enforcement agencies as sex offenders. The process involves providing personal information, including name, address, and a description of the offense. Registration is typically required for a specified period, depending on the severity of the crime.
